An extraordinary collaboration between Dutch-Indonesian theatre maker, Gerard Mosterd, and world renowned, Bessie Award-winning Sumatran choreographer, Boi Sakti.The world was a paradise.
In this paradise women ruled.
There were no possessions, no war and violence.
Eroticism was not a taboo and there was freedom and tolerance.
